云服务器如何配置ip
云服务器如何配置ip
2026-03-27 04:57
云服务器IP配置需规划网络架构、选择地址类型,结合控制台与CLI操作,优化安全策略,并配以实时监控与应急方案管理。
云服务器如何配置IP地址:全面指南与实操解析
在数字化运营中,云服务器的IP地址配置是支撑业务稳定运行的关键环节。本文将系统梳理从基础准备到进阶应用的完整流程,帮助用户掌握不同场景下的配置策略。
一、IP地址配置前的准备工作
1.1 网络架构规划设计
配置IP前需明确服务器应用场景与网络需求。首先确定服务器所属的虚拟专用网络(VPC)或子网范围,常见的架构设计需考虑:
- 单IP与多IP分配策略
- 内网IP与公网IP的使用比例
- 弹性IP的预分配机制 以电商平台为例,通常需设置3个内网IP用于数据库、应用服务器与缓存服务,并分配1个固定公网IP承载外部访问流量。
1.2 地址资源获取条件
运营商对IP地址的审批有严格标准,企业用户需:
- 准备ICP备案审核材料
- 确定IPv6与IPv4的使用策略
- 评估地址段与子网掩码需求 据行业经验,至少预留10%的地址冗余空间以应对拓展需求,避免后期频繁申请新增备案。
1.3 本地网络环境检测
建立安全连接前,应完成:
# 检查路由表配置
route -n
# 验证域名解析能力
nslookup example.com
# 测试防火墙有效性
iptables -L -n -v
通过模拟内外网互连场景,可排查80%的常见网络问题。
二、云服务器IP配置标准流程
2.1 控制台操作流程
主流云平台均提供图形化配置入口:
- 登录管理控制台定位目标实例
- 进入网络与安全组配置界面
- 选择绑定新IP或弹性IP
- 保存配置并查看状态变更 不同平台的操作时效性参差不齐,例如阿里云通常在30秒内生效,而部分国际平台可能会有2-5分钟延迟。
2.2 CLI工具精简配置
掌握命令行工具可显著提升维护效率:
# AWS EC2弹性IP分配示例
aws ec2 allocate-address --domain vpc
# 云平台指定内网IP
aws ec2 run-instances --private-ip-address 192.168.1.10
建议将常用命令整合为Shell脚本,建立标准化操作模板。
2.3 SSH安全连接设置
完成IP绑定后,需及时调整安全策略:
# 典型安全组配置示例
- Protocol: TCP
Port: 22
CIDR: 203.0.113.0/32
Type: IPv4
- Protocol: UDP
Port: 53
CIDR: 0.0.0.0/0
Type: IPv6
注意关闭不必要的协议端口,建议将SSH端口改为非标准端口以提高安全性。
三、关键注意事项与性能优化
3.1 地址类型选择原则
| 地址类型 | 适用场景 | 管理成本 | 稳定性 |
|---|---|---|---|
| 弹性IP(EIP) | 需要长期对外服务的业务 | 中等 | 高 |
| 自动分配IP | 临时测试环境 | 低 | 一般 |
| IPv6地址 | 海量设备接入场景 | 高 | 最高 |
建议采用弹性IP与自动分配IP混合使用,重要业务系统应优先部署IPv6地址池。
3.2 规则管理最佳实践
- 使用分层命名策略:如"backend/db/zone-01"
- 建立变更文档记录:保留每次IP配置变更的详细说明
- 实施分级授权制度:区分运维组与业务组的配置权限 某企业曾因未记录IP变更导致故障,最终花费7小时排查,强调规则管理的重要性。
3.3 实时监控与调优
推荐部署网络性能监控系统,重点关注:
- IP地址利用率(建议低于70%)
- 流量异常波动(突增50%以上需预警)
- DNS解析平均耗时(控制在200ms内) 通过时序数据库(TSDB)存储历史数据,可辅助实施动态带宽调整策略。
四、特殊场景配置技巧
4.1 多IP绑定方案
对高性能Web服务器配置方案:
# 添加虚拟IP(VIP)示例
ip addr add 192.168.1.200 dev eth0 label eth0:1
# 调整路由优先级
ip route add 10.0.0.0/8 dev eth0
注意需同时配置ARP缓存更新策略,确保网络设备正确识别新IP。
4.2 服务部署协同方案
在微服务架构中,IP配置需与服务发现组件联动:
lb.ephemeral_port_range: 30000-40000
server.custom_ip: 172.16.0.10
通过预定义IP段简化服务注册流程,避免因IP变化导致的服务中断。
4.3 API自动化管理
创建自定义云管平台模块时,需支持以下接口:
{
"operation": "assign_ip",
"resource_id": "i-123456",
"ip_type": "primary",
"region": "ap-southeast-1"
}
接口设计应包含熔断机制与异步操作支持,适应大规模并发请求场景。
五、典型配置案例分析
5.1 电商网站IP配置
某购物平台采用双活架构:
[前置网关]
├─ 主站:EIP × 4
├─ 支付系统:私网IP + 私有网关
└─ 数据库集群:内网IP × 8
通过规划10.10.0.0/16私有地址段,实现前后端彻底隔离通讯。
5.2 游戏服务器IP优化
跨国游戏公司的网络方案:
Region | IP类型 | 带宽预留
北京节点 | EIP+NAT | 500Mbps
新加坡 | 浮动IP | 1Gbps
法兰克福 | 固定IP | 800Mbps
根据地理位置差异,采用动态弹性带宽与静态IP结合的模式,降低跨区域延迟。
六、故障排查与应急预案
6.1 典型故障定位法
构建问题排查流程:
- 检查IP绑定状态(控制台/CLI)
- 验证防火墙规则(云平台安全组+系统级iptables)
- 测试网络连通性(mtr/traceroute)
- 分析路由表配置(ip route show)
某金融机构曾通过该流程,15分钟定位到因子网掩码配置错误导致的80端口无法访问问题。
6.2 应急响应方案
建议建立三层应急机制:
- 自动化检测:流量突变触发IP漂移
- 手动热备:预置备用IP池
- 人工介入:定义不同等级问题的响应时效 预留应急IP池应确保至少2组地址可供快速切换,避免业务连续性风险。
完整掌握云服务器IP配置需要理解网络架构设计原理、熟悉平台操作规范、建立系统化管理机制。通过标准化操作流程与自动化工具相结合,可有效提升服务器管理效率,为构建高可用系统奠定基础。建议结合具体业务场景,测试不同配置方案的容灾能力,形成定制化的IP管理策略。